Ok I am new to this process. I do weld quite well with a stick welder. I have started restoring old cars as well as my old tractors and need to weld on the fenders or lets say thin metal. Question is should I use Argon/CO2 and thin wire or the flux core. My welder came with .035 flux core. I see that you can get it in .030 flux core. Will this work for fender type welding. Or do I need to go to the smaller .023 and argon/co2

Hi Steve,

Using flux cored Mig on lite gauge SM is like using stick electrodes. Both will get the job done but oxy/act, solid wire Mig with 75He/25Ar, or Tig will be a better process choice.

Use alot of tacks as lite gauge SM likes to move and warp. The closer your tack welds are the last amount of warpage will result.

Joint prep is critical for warpage control. The wider the gap, the more filler rod that has to be applied to the joint thus creating a stronger contraction creating warpage as the metal cools.

Weld is position is critical. 45� vertical down is a great position as it lets you weld faster with sligtly less penetration and a slightly narrow bead width.

With 75He/25Ar cover gas the He content will let the bead lay flater for less work during the shaping phase. For a home shop use 100% Ar works well and with correct joint prep and welder technique can be used as well as the 75He/25Ar mix. Pure Ar will cost 30% less than a Ar/mixed gas.

I agree that Mig with .023 wire is a good size for lite gauge work. .030 also works well to about 22ga.

.035 flux core is bad news for any kind of sheet metal work. I've tried and the thinnest I suggest to even try with it is 14ga. 16ga is tough and 20ga is just short of impossible. If you try and do sheet metal with flux core, you will become really good friends with a grinder.

Go with the argon/co2 mix. I use .023 wire and am very happy with the results. I tried flux core and it splatters all over the place. The good thing about MIG is that anyone with the least bit of tallent can weld with it.

HI Steve

I like the gas mix of 75/25 Argon/CO2 for this type of work, it give you a wetter,wider puddle [fluxing action] with slightly less penatratiion.

The thinner/smaller dia. wire takes less amps. that will produce less heat for disstorion [sp?] Tho you may need to go to a different liner and drive rolls, tip to run it. When possiable [sp? again] on the inside a chill bar of copper or alum. [as a second choice] could be used to help with this and burn-thru.

Myself I prefer soild wire over the flux core-until I get to .045 & I mostly will run this duel-shield [with gas].
